Situated in Preston, Lancashire, this inviting 3-bedroom townhouse is an ideal accommodation for up to six guests. Conveniently located near major motorways such as the M6, M65, and M55, it is just a five-minute drive from the city center and the train station. Nestled on a tranquil, friendly street, guests can take advantage of private off-road parking or on-street options. Upon entering, visitors are greeted by a welcoming hallway, complete with the Wi-Fi code for easy connectivity. The modern living room offers a cozy atmosphere, featuring a 43" smart TV for streaming favorite shows.
The spacious kitchen and dining area is fully equipped for culinary endeavors, whether guests wish to prepare their meals or indulge in local takeaways. This area seamlessly connects to a private backyard, which serves as a delightful sun trap, perfect for relaxation. On the upper floor, guests will find a contemporary three-piece bathroom with a bath and power shower, along with three generously sized bedrooms, each furnished with comfortable double beds to ensure a restful night’s sleep.
Guests will appreciate the townhouse's proximity to various attractions, including Preston Docklands and Marina, as well as the bustling main shopping district featuring three shopping centers, numerous bars, restaurants, and entertainment options. The location is particularly convenient, being just three minutes from the University, five minutes from BAE, and ten minutes from local hospitals and the Budweiser brewery. Additionally, popular destinations such as Blackpool and Lytham are accessible within 30 minutes, while the Lake District can be reached in 40 minutes, and both Manchester and Liverpool are just 50 minutes away.
Nature enthusiasts can explore the area's scenic beauty at Brockholes Nature Reserve and Longton Brickcroft Nature Reserve, while cultural highlights include the Museum of Lancashire and the Harris Museum and Art Gallery. For those looking to engage in local events or sports, Deepdale and Sir Tom Finney Stadium are nearby. Outdoor activities abound, with opportunities for motor boating and fishing, as well as mountain biking and cycling in the surrounding areas, making this townhouse a perfect base for both relaxation and adventure.
